Key facts on the subject
- Location: Strumica is located in the Strumica Plain between Belasica, OgraĹľden and Elenica in southeastern North Macedonia.
- Regional significance: Strumica is considered a cultural and regional centre in the southeast and has a multifaceted history.
- Cultural themes: Historical sites, churches, monasteries, as well as museums and cultural institutions shape the region’s cultural exploration.

Culture, religious sites and regional collections
The cultural and religious sites of the Strumica cultural region include Tsar’s Towers, the Orta Mosque, churches and monasteries. These names provide specific themes for planning your trip: you can combine historical sites with religious architecture while learning about the region’s cultural development through different forms of evidence.
Museums and cultural institutions in Strumica preserve archaeological, historical and ethnological evidence from the region. Excursions in the surrounding area
Destinations mentioned in the wider area around Strumica include the Roman Baths near Bansko, monasteries in Veljusa and Bansko, as well as waterfalls. These places form part of the nearer or wider regional area and should be considered separately from the city of Strumica.
